Due to the restrictions of transporting stoves and fuel in checked airplane luggage I wish to buy a canister stove when I arrive in St Jean Pied de Port. Is there an outfitter in the town? Reason: This will be my second time on the Camino, but this time I will be turning East onto the GR 11 at Col de Bentarte to follow the Senda to the Mediterranean instead of continuing on to Santiago.
